Where does City of Othello publish RFPs?
City of Othello publishes formal RFPs on its official website and WA's state procurement portal. We're currently tracking 25 solicitations from City of Othello. The most active RFP sectors are Capital Projects, Parks & Recreation, Public Works. Aggregating all sources into one place ensures you never miss an opportunity.
Who makes purchasing decisions at City of Othello?
At City of Othello, purchasing decisions are overseen by the city manager or mayor's office, with department heads across Public Works, IT, Finance, and Public Safety. Key departments include Administration, Parks & Recreation, Municipal Court, Library, and Information Technology.
